Output 364d5ba89ea631cb835d75dcfba6c632ef8d768a2d77a62fcccc16d2272cdfc4:0

value
5805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 122223d8f7bde305125518404c41488b00952889 OP_EQUAL
address
33Ltz62hwV7oQyk9qtTjsbBHRP9itWUYWg
transaction
364d5ba89ea631cb835d75dcfba6c632ef8d768a2d77a62fcccc16d2272cdfc4
confirmations
207839
spent
true